What I meant was, you use iphoto as your only photo management software, correct? If so, open iphoto, control click on any random photo and select "show file." This will open up your iphoto library in the finder as if it were a regular folder, then open the enclosing folder to see all the folders in the iphoto directory. Now just look through the folders and see if you can find the missing photos.

*** DO NOT CHANGE ANYTHING ABOUT THESE FOLDERS OR FILES!!!! If you do, then iphoto will be wrecked, which is why Apple made access to these folders so hidden. Just open these folders and see if you can find the missing photos, but do nothing else to the photos at all.
